Britain’s Gambling Regulator: The Primary Regulator
All permitted betting in Great Britain is based on the authority of the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). Created by the Gambling Act 2005, this independent body possesses the ability to authorise, supervise, and police the industry. Every platform offering casino games like Shining Crown to UK customers needs a current operating licence from the Commission. The UKGC’s job does not end at providing permits. It constantly watches operators to ensure they follow its Licence Conditions and Codes of Practice (LCCP). These rules regulate fair play, safeguarding of player funds, anti-money laundering, and social responsibility. This monitoring guarantees a minimum of safety for all players.
Regulatory Requirements for Internet Slots
For Shining Crown Slot to be provided lawfully to UK players, the organisation behind shining-crown.net must secure and hold specific licenses from the gambling regulator. The essential one is a Remote Operating Licence, which enables a company to offer gambling over the internet. Just as important, the organisation that designed the slot software must hold a Remote Software Licence. This licence confirms the integrity of the game’s Random Number Generator (RNG) and the fairness of its systems. The permit holder also has to display its licence number and a link to the UKGC registry clearly on its website. This layered system builds a chain of oversight from the game developer right to the player.
Player Protections and Ethical Accountability
Carrying a UKGC licence implies following rigorous social responsibility and player protection rules. These rules directly affect your time with Shining Crown Slot. They seek to minimize gambling harm and create a more secure atmosphere. Protections include compulsory age and identity checks before you can claim winnings, easy-to-find tools for setting deposit limits or self-excluding, and detailed information on game rules and the theoretical return-to-player (RTP) percentage. Sites must also provide links to support groups like GamCare and BeGambleAware. For you, this framework signifies playing Shining Crown Slot on a licensed site comes with automatic safeguards and clear paths to assistance if things go wrong.
Equity and Arbitrariness Accreditation
A slot’s fairness is paramount, and UK regulation upholds this thoroughly. The software powering Shining Crown Slot needs to be tested and certified by an unbiased lab authorized by the UKGC. Organisations like eCOGRA or iTech Labs conduct thorough audits on the game’s Random Number Generator (RNG). They validate that any spin result is authentically random, indeterminate, and unaltered. These auditors also check that the game’s stated RTP percentage is mathematically accurate. Operators may not get a license without these certification reports. They offer players a numerical guarantee of the game’s reliability. Operators have to re-test games periodically to preserve their certification current.

Fund Protection and Privacy Safeguards
When you try Shining Crown Slot with real money, the security of your cash and your personal details is a cornerstone of the UK legal setup. Licence conditions force operators to keep customer deposits in segregated bank accounts, separate from the company’s own business funds. This safeguards your money if the operator were to go bankrupt. On data, operators must follow UK data protection law, including the UK GDPR. Your personal and financial information must be collected legally, stored under high security, and used only for the reasons stated. Playing on a UKGC-licensed platform lets you trust that your money and your data are handled safely.
Consequences of Breach for Licensees
The UK Gambling Commission does not hesitate to use its enforcement powers. Penalties for breaking licence conditions are significant and are meant to resolve problems and warn the wider industry. This active enforcement serves players by maintaining market standards high. The potential consequences for an operator include:
- Hefty financial penalties, which can amount to millions of pounds.
- Temporary revocation or complete revocation of the operating licence, terminating its UK business.
- Written warnings and extra licence conditions imposed on the operator.
- Official announcement of enforcement actions, harming the operator’s reputation.
- Legal prosecution under the Gambling Act 2005 in the most serious cases.
